1. Layout and Space Optimization

Before picking furniture or lighting, assess your room’s dimensions and potential. Whether converting a spare bedroom or corner of the basement, maximizing space flow keeps the room functional and inviting. Use multi-functional furniture such as gaming desks with storage or adjustable shelves for consoles and accessories. Don’t forget to keep pathways clear to avoid tripping over wires and gear.

2. Comfortable Seating for Marathon Sessions

Investing in ergonomic seating is crucial for your comfort and posture. Gaming chairs with lumbar support, adjustable height, and breathable fabric can make hours spent gaming pain-free. For a budget-friendly option, consider adding plush cushions to a sturdy office chair or using bean bags for a casual vibe.

3. Lighting: Set the Mood and Reduce Eye Strain

Ambient lighting dramatically changes a gaming room’s atmosphere. Combine LED strip lights behind your monitor or desk with ceiling fixtures that offer dimmable warmth or coolness depending on the time of day. Avoid harsh overhead lights directly reflecting off screens, and consider smart bulbs for customizable color options that match your game or mood.

4. Soundproofing and Acoustics

Good sound quality and privacy are often overlooked but vital for immersive gaming. Use thick curtains, area rugs, or DIY foam panels to dampen echoes. If you stream or play multiplayer online games, soundproofing protects your household’s peace and minimizes distractions.

Step-by-Step DIY Improvements for Your Gaming Room

You don’t need a professional interior designer to build your dream gaming room. These simple DIY tips will empower you to personalize your space with minimal cost and effort:

  • Step 1: Cable Management — Tame your cables by installing adhesive cable clips along your desk’s edge or mounting a power strip underneath with velcro straps. This keeps cords out of sight for a neat, hazard-free area.
  • Step 2: Custom Gaming Desk — Repurpose a sturdy table or build your own gaming desk tailored for multiple monitors and consoles. Incorporate shelving and holes for cable routing.
  • Step 3: Wall Mounts & Shelving — Free up desk space by wall mounting your TV or monitors and adding floating shelves for game cases, collectibles, and speakers.
  • Step 4: DIY LED Decor — Add personality with LED light strips or DIY neon signs. You can even create pixel art or game-themed wall accents using inexpensive materials like plywood and paint.
  • Step 5: Acoustic Panels — Use inexpensive acoustic foam or make your own sound panels by wrapping fabric around wooden frames filled with insulating material. This improves audio clarity and reduces noise disturbances.

Design Inspiration: Themes and Styles for Your Gaming Room

Your gaming room should be an extension of your personality and taste. Here are a few popular themes to inspire your design:

Futuristic & Cyberpunk

Think neon lights, black glossy surfaces, and high-tech accessories. Use LED strips with bold colors (pink, blue, purple) and sleek metal furniture for a high-tech vibe.

Cozy & Minimalist

Soft neutrals, natural wood, and clean lines create a welcoming and uncluttered space. Prioritize ergonomics and ambient lighting over flashy decor.

Retro Gaming Nostalgia

Integrate vintage consoles, arcade cabinets, and pixel art wall decor. Use bright colors and nostalgic memorabilia to celebrate gaming’s roots.

Practical Tips for Maintaining Your Gaming Room

  • Regular Cleaning: Dust off your electronics and vacuum carpets to keep equipment dust-free and in good shape.
  • Update Equipment: Schedule hardware upgrades on an annual basis to keep your setup fast and future-proof.
  • Personal Touches: Rotate posters, collectibles, or plants to keep the environment fresh and inspiring.

What is the best lighting for a gaming room?

The best lighting combines ambient and task lighting with adjustable color temperatures. LED strip lights behind monitors reduce eye strain, while dimmable ceiling lights help create the right mood without screen glare.

How can I soundproof my gaming room on a budget?

Use thick curtains, area rugs, and DIY acoustic panels made with foam or insulation wrapped in fabric. Even rearranging furniture to cover bare walls helps reduce echo and noise spillover.

What furniture is essential for a gaming room?

At minimum, an ergonomic gaming chair, a sturdy desk with cable management options, and functional shelving units make your gaming room efficient and comfortable. Add a couch or bean bag for multiplayer or casual lounging.
